# Break-Glass: Catalog Cache Invalidation

Scope: the Pinrow product catalog at Veldstone Retail. If stale prices persist after a purge and the Hollowmere invalidation queue is wedged, use break-glass to flush the edge tier directly. Contractors: get verbal sign-off from the catalog lead first. Steps: open the Hollowmere admin shell, select emergency-flush, confirm the tenant, and run it once — repeated flushes thrash the origin. Access is logged and expires after 20 minutes. Unseal the admin shell with the passphrase below.

recovery phrase for kahop-tajog: istix-casvan

TURN-208: Gatevale turnstile counters at the Merrow Field pilot double-count when a rotation reverses mid-cycle. Attendance totals drift roughly 2% high per event. The debounce window fix is implemented, reviewed by Ilsa, and soak-tested across two simulated match days without drift. Ready for your cut; the candidate build is identified below.

trace token, tagag-tafog: htk6_5ed18c

## Formula sandbox tuning

User-supplied formulas in Gridmoor execute inside a restricted interpreter with hard ceilings on time, memory, and call depth. Reviewers should confirm any change to these ceilings is justified in the PR description, since raising them widens the abuse surface. Defaults were chosen from production traces. The current limits are as follows.

limits module of tafog-fawip:
WEIGHTS = {
    "julix": 57,
    "lamys": 992,
    "kasvan": 209,
    "quenok": 750,
    "alddor": 259,
    "oliath": 1009,
    "wenix": 815,
}

**Q: Are the lifts running this weekend?** No. Both lifts in the Halloway Annexe are down for winch maintenance Saturday 06:00 to Sunday 18:00. Direct staff to the east stairwell. Goods deliveries should be deferred or rerouted via the Penfold loading dock. Contractors from Bray Vertical Systems will be on site; they sign in at the facilities desk as normal. The stairwell door locks after 19:00, so anyone working late will need the weekend access code. Issue it only to rostered staff. The code is below.

badge for bawef-bahap: bdg-LALUM-4